Manchester United still have work to do in the transfer market despite adding Benjamin Sesko to their ranks and taking their spending past £200million for the summer

United have had a strong pre-season under Amorim(Image: 2025 Manchester United FC)

There is less than a week until the return of the Premier League and Ruben Amorim will soon learn if his side have progressed over the summer. The Portuguese has a new frontline at his disposal after a deal for Benjamin Sesko was confirmed, to add to recent additions Bryan Mbeumo and Matheus Cunha.

Sesko was paraded to fans in advance of the club’s final friendly against Fiorentina at Old Trafford. United did not manage to put in a remarkable display but it signalled a landmark en route to the season beginning.

But there is work still to be done. Rasmus Hojlund was in the squad for the game but did not feature amid speculation around his future, while the Red Devils will still hope to find clubs for Tyrell Malacia, Jadon Sancho, Antony and Alejandro Garnacho.

And while Old Trafford chiefs may hope to see funds replenished, there are areas of the team that still require improvement. Amorim surely would not say no to having a quality midfielder added to his ranks.

Hojlund U-turn

Rasmus Hojlund has admitted defeat and is prepared to consider an exit from Manchester United after the signing of Benjamin Sesko pushed him further down the pecking order. The Dane previously stated his intention to fight for his place and rejected the notion of a move to RB Leipzig but United have remained open to his departure.

The striker is now more receptive to the idea of leaving Old Trafford after AC Milan came to the table, reports TalkSport. The Italians giants are in talks with United over a loan with opotion to buy with the Red Devils set for a significant loss after spending more than £70m two years ago.

New Sancho answer

Jadon Sancho is said to be on Atletico Madrid’s shortlist of targets for the final weeks of the transfer window. According to Fichajes, Diego Simeone wants to add to his squad out wide and the Manchester United flop is among those of interest.

Sancho had appeared set to join Juventus but that move has seen little progress, while Borussia Dortmund have returned as a possible contender for his signature. The England international could yet find himself with options to consider with Simeone claimed to see Sancho ‘as a potential game-changer on the flanks’ with his direct style suiting a counter-attacking philosophy.

United speak to agents

Manchester United were in contact with agents of Brighton star Carlos Baleba over the weekend, per reports. United remain intent on advancing a deal via the player, as they did with Benjamin Sesko, before making an agreement with the Seagulls.

Contract and salary remain under discussion, while contact remains with Brighton, though not advanced. Baleba is said to be interested in the move with United want to try and get a deal over the line, with personal terms not expected to be an issue.

If their efforts do not pay off in the coming weeks, expect a return next summer.
